Output 50568f21ae27b54f8a296ab7f70a37c708728706cff46020b2f2fae53b43644e:0

value
25076
script pubkey
OP_0 OP_PUSHBYTES_20 1ac8bcb099119d665abaed78dfac4e76f83476c7
address
bc1qrtytevyezxwkvk46a4udltzwwmurgak8chl8yz
transaction
50568f21ae27b54f8a296ab7f70a37c708728706cff46020b2f2fae53b43644e
spent
true